The Story Behind Winter in Wartime
Okay, so let’s dive deeper into the story behind Winter in Wartime, or Oorlogswinter as it’s known in Dutch. This film is based on the novel of the same name by Jan Terlouw, a well-respected Dutch author. The story is set in the winter of 1944-1945, during the final months of the German occupation of the Netherlands. Our main character is Michiel van Beusekom, a 14-year-old boy living in a small Dutch village. Michiel is a typical teenager, but his life is turned upside down when he becomes involved with the Dutch Resistance. It all starts when he helps a wounded British airman, Jack, who has crashed near his village. Michiel, fueled by a sense of duty and adventure, decides to hide Jack and help him escape back to Allied territory. This decision plunges him into a dangerous world of secrets, betrayal, and constant fear. As Michiel gets more involved with the Resistance, he begins to see the war in a new light. He witnesses the bravery of ordinary people risking their lives to fight for freedom, but he also sees the devastating consequences of violence and oppression. The story isn't just about the war itself; it's about Michiel's coming-of-age during this tumultuous time. He learns about trust, loyalty, and the difficult choices that war forces upon individuals. The novel and the film adaptation both beautifully capture the atmosphere of fear and uncertainty that permeated daily life in occupied Netherlands. They also highlight the resilience and courage of the Dutch people who resisted the Nazi regime in various ways. Winter in Wartime isn't just a war story; it's a story about growing up, making tough decisions, and finding your place in the world, even when the world is at its darkest.
